Becoming a mason in Vancouver, OR, typically begins with an apprenticeship, which combines hands-on experience with classroom learning, allowing individuals to earn while they learn. Apprenticeships in the masonry trade last about four to five years, requiring many hours of training under licensed professionals. According to the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, there are approximately 8,647 masonry workers in Oregon, with an average weekly wage of $1,240. The Bureau of Labor Statistics projects a 0% job growth from 2023 to 2033, but with approximately 21,800 openings annually due to retirements and transfers. Trade schools, unions, and platforms like Gild help aspiring masons find apprenticeship opportunities, leading to a career with strong earning potential—often exceeding $67,000 annually for experienced professionals.
